In the 1960s and ’70s, the Italian design collective Superstudio protested modern urban design by poking fun at the status quo and imagining its own utopias. "One photo collage series, called “Continuous Monument,” depicts a monolithic shape slicing through deserts, spanning the Grand Canyon and gliding over the Hudson River to superimpose Lower Manhattan’s grid with its own lattice design. This form’s unstoppable advancement through natural and urban landscapes seems to warn against the dulling effect of clean modern lines and the dangers of unchecked urban expansion....... Also on display...are the group’s range of lurid-colored sofas, which mock the ’60s fe**sh for functional design, and “Supersurface,” a series of drawings and collages that show nomads roaming a fantasy landscape, freed of consumerist desire."

Make sure to watch the video, also placed in the first comment. https://www.msn.com/en-us/video/animals/the-british-farm-where-the-animals-rule/vi-BB19CR2l This is how rewilding restores vast swaths of arid land and brings back biodiversity.

"They decided to turn to nature for a solution and in 2001, set about "rewilding" the estate. Knepp is now home to an astonishing array of biodiversity and has become a celebrated conservation success story, attracting many rare species and transforming the landscape from English country farm to untamed wilderness.
"We were living in a biological desert," says Tree. "Now, ecologists are blown away all the time by just the amount of life here."

Concrete is responsible for about 8% of global carbon emissions (while the construction industry as a whole is responsible for a much larger %-age, in addition to producing toxic waste, and in the case of subdivision development, destroying tree-d areas and ecosystems when not designed/planned properly.).
Several companies are working to create a more environmentally friendly mix of concrete.

"If our communities are ever going to reopen during the pandemic...they need to find more ways to keep people apart and to make better use of outdoor space.
That’s the premise behind Design for Distancing, a planning initiative in Baltimore that has brought architects and public health experts together to develop tactical solutions for modifying city streets and sidewalks so they work better for the restaurants, stores, and services that are seeking to reopen after the long government-imposed lockdown."
